2

当我使用 Call 方法时,我的对话框确实已加载,但是,我首先从模拟器收到来自机器人的空消息,只有在我发送给机器人的下一条消息时,我才会进入对话对话。任何想法为什么会发生这种情况?

context.Call<MyDialog>(new FormDialog<MyDialog>(new MyDialog()), Afterwards);

一旦我打电话,我想直接进入我的对话对话context.Call

4

1 回答 1

7

添加PromptInStartFormOption 解决了我的问题,谢谢。

context.Call<MyDialog>(new FormDialog<MyDialog>(new MyDialog(), options: FormOptions.PromptInStart), Afterwards);
于 2016-04-12T21:49:42.667 回答